On March 23,2003 Lt. Phil Losi of the Buffalo Fire Department arrived at the scene of a fire at 715 Delaware Avenue.  Dense smoke was emanating from the building and the doors were locked.  A neighbor advised Lt. Losi that a woman was still inside.  Without thought for his own safety he kicked in the door and entered the smoke filled building.  No water lines were in place and he encountered high heat and impenetrable smoke.  He found the semi-conscious woman with her hair in flames.  Lt. Losi extinguished her burning hair and carried the woman to safety.  As a result of his quick and selfless actions a woman's life was saved.
      The 100 Club of Buffalo & Western New York recognize Lieutenant Phil Losi for his heroic actions of March 23, 2003.
